I will come back to the Senator with confirmation on the local authority members. My understanding is that if somebody is a local authority member and went full-time as a councillor in the last five years but prior to that was paying PRSI as part of their farm income, self-employment or as an employee, they are able to make voluntary contributions. I will have to double check that. By putting Senator Higgins's proposal into regulation, anyone who had not made a credited contribution within the past five years would be able to make voluntary contributions. Let me check that before the Senator writes out to councillors telling them in case I am mistaken.
